Avoid debt whenever you can. There are certain types of debt that you cannot escape like mortgages. Yet you should not opt to take out credit cards and build debt that way. Avoid borrowing money that has high interest rates and fees associated with it.

Your car and house are likely to be the biggest purchases you will make. Payments and interest payments on those items are probably going to make up the bulk of your budget every month. Paying these expenses quickly can reduce the interest payments that you will incur.

You can see a decrease in your credit score as you are making repairs. You may not have done anything to hurt it. Keep paying your bills on time and doing the right things, and your score will rise eventually.

Open a new savings account at your bank, and deposit money into it on a regular basis. Having funds saved can help you access money quickly in an emergency or because of unforeseen circumstances. You may not be able to put much in each month, but it is still important to save regularly.

TIP! Savings should be the first thing you take from each check. Saving money left when the month ends will not likely to happen.

Reducing the number of meals you eat at restaurants and fast food joints can be a great way to decrease your monthly expenses. Buying the ingredients and putting meals together at home will save one money, as well as giving one an appreciation for the effort it takes to make good tasting meals.

You may want to consider getting a checking account that has no fees. Some of your main options will include credit unions, online banks and some major chain banks.
